Whoever painted yours really did an excellent job. My painter said it will be somewhere between 250-300 hours depending on if I have my FIKSE FM-10's painted and if I have them roll my fenders. The fronts are 18X10 with a 265/35/18 Pirelli P-Zero Assymetrico tires and the rears are 18X11.5 with same Pirelli tires in a 295/30/18. I have heard that 305/30/19 fit as well as 315/30/18 on the rear but I am unsure if that was with rolled fenders, I assume it was, and how the suspension sits.
